hi, i want to get nss12 but i don't know if you put neflon inside the c band or not, and direction of the wire of lnb. Help me please

Indeed, for NSS12 C-band, the Teflon is required. As a rule, it's always required for circular (Right-R, and Left-L) polarized signals. For V & H signals, (such as those on Intelsat 20 Intelsat 20 at 68.5°E - LyngSat) it isn't required.

According to Satellite Finder / Dish Alignment Calculator with Google Maps | DishPointer.com, the LNB skew should be set at 86.3degrees, that is around 3 o'clock position when facing the dish.

All the best.
